Chris Page

Ranking
642
Merit
-
England

Dafydd Howell

Ranking
93
Merit
117
England

Overall Record

20 Tournaments 40
145 Matches 219
84 Wins 129
5 Draws 10
56 Losses 80
57.93 Win % 58.90
59 (23 Apr 17) Highest Rank 22 (7 Jan 24)

Head to Head Record

1
20 Aug 16 |  UK Open UK   - Group 02

Ranking History